Title: To authorize the Director of Finance and Management, on behalf of the Department of Public Service, Division of Infrastructure Management, to enter into contract with Southeastern Equipment Company, Inc. for a paver with a trailer to improve the roadways of Columbus; to waive the competitive bidding provisions of City Code Chapter 329; to authorize the expenditure of $221,700.00 from the Municipal Motor Vehicle Tax Fund (Fund 2266), and to declare an emergency. Explanation
1. BACKGROUND
This ordinance authorizes the Director of Finance and Management to enter into a contract with Southeastern Equipment Company, Inc. for the purchase of one (1) paver with a trailer for the Department of Public Service, Division of Infrastructure Management. The Division of Infrastructure Management will use it to improve various roadways in Columbus. The City of Columbus, Fleet Management Division, approved the one (1) paver with a trailer. The paver with a trailer is replacing BT-20596.
The Purchasing Office advertised and solicited competitive bids in accordance with the relevant provisions of City Code, Chapter 329 relating to competitive bidding (Solicitation RFQ012589) through Vendor Services. The City received two (2) bids on June 27, 2019, (both majority) and tabulated as follows:
Company Name Bid Amount City/State Majority/MBE/FBE
Southeastern Equipment Company, Inc. $221,700.00 Dublin, OH Majority
Holden Industries, Inc. $32,358.00 South West City, MO Majority
The Department of Public Service, Division of Infrastructure is requesting to waive bidding provisions of City Code Chapter 329, enter directly into contract with Southeastern Equipment Company, Inc., and to establish a purchase order with Southeastern Equipment Company, Inc. to purchase the paver with a trailer. Southeastern Equipment Company, Inc. was the only bidder to submit a bid with a paver and trailer together. However, the vendor did not submit its exceptions to the bid in the allocated time, which makes them non-responsive, requiring a bid waiver. The bid waiver for Southeastern Equipment Company, Inc. allows the Division of Infrastructure Management to receive the new paver with a trailer around the time of the new mill machine, which work in tandem to improve roadway in Columbus.
Searches in the System for Award Management (Federal) and the Findings for Recovery list (State) produced no findings against Southeastern Equipment Company, Inc.
